A parallel circuit consists of two capacitor c1=10mF and c2=15mF what is the total Capacitance
tensa zangetsu [6.8K]

Answer:

C = 25 mF

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that,

Two capacitors with capacitances 10mF and 15mF are connected in parallel.

We need to find the total capacitance of the capacitors.

For a parallel combination, the equivalent capacitance is given by :

C_P=C_1+C_2

Substituting the values,

C_P=10+15\\\\=25\ mF

So, the total capacitance of the combination of capacitors is 25 mF.
